I dont really know what to say about this song,apart from that I love it!
This song wasnt really popular with the main stream,up until recently when it was released on single after much demand. If im honest I first heard this song being blasted out loud on mobile phones on the bus,by 'Chavs' as my dad calls them. Music being played out loud on buses really makes me realise that I need to take my driving test again as it annoys me so much,but this song being played made my bus journey more enjoyable!
T2 features Jodie Aysha,who has a very girly voice,or in some peoples opinions..annoying! True,she has a girl like voice,but I think it compliments the song perfectly.
Heartbroken is a garage track. I usually cannot abide garage music,as I find it annoying,but this track just has something else.
For all of you that dont know the track,its the one that has a woman singing 'Im Heartbroken,without your love,Heartbroken cos i've had enough,Heartbroken n I dont know what to say..I've never felt this way'
You rarely hear it on the radio,however there is a radio edit.
I bought the single in HMV for 2.99p,which I think is about the going rate for a single these days.
It consists of 6 tracks and number 7 being the video,to put in your computer. Although theres no point in doing that in my opinion because the video really confuses me,it seems rushed together,but to an extent this doesnt really matter as its a great track. The c.d cover is very plain to look at too,as its plain black with a smashed piece of glass on the front. T2 and Heartbroken is written in white,with 'Featuring Jodie Aysha' in red underneath. However the plain appearance really doesnt matter as the single makes up for any mistakes.
The first track is the 'Radio edit': This is the track that was played alot on radio 1,on the garage sessions that they have later at night. This is probably the track you will generally recognise,however I didnt as I have an extended version that I got from Myspace as a download. 9.5/10!
Track 2:Extended mix. This is about 4 and a half minutes long,and in my opinion is better than the radio edit,which is a rarity as in this day and age,a single is usually complimented with a terrible remix to fill the c.d up. A big 10/10
Track 3:WAWA Club Mix.: This track is almost dancy,in a chill out type of way. If anyone is aware of Hed Kandi,then it seems very similar to some of the things that you would find on a Hed Kandi c.d. Basically garage,with a dance/chill out twist. 9/10
Track 4: This is more of a filler,but amazingly is really good. Fillers are usually poor in quality,but this track has a killer beat and will appeal to all with a wide taste in music,as it samples a good dancy beat,while maintaining a garage theme. 8/10
Track 5:Wideboys London Mix: Again a filler but a killer. This track is still garagey,but with a pop type theme to it. Its almost remeniscant of early Craig David,in the beat and the arrangement of the music. 9/10
Track 6: Wideboys Radio edit This ofcause samples the song 'Heartbroken',but is very dancy in its form. Its the kind of thing that you would find in a club,in the early hours in the chill-out rooms. Very layed back and a fantastic mix. 8/10
I personally think this c.d is great value for money,as its rare to find a single that consists of so many tracks and quality tracks at that. If you like the song then i'd definately recommend the single to you as the mixes are consistently good in quality and dont have any boring fillers. Ofcause garage is not to everyones taste,but I liked the track and hated garage music,so it worth having a listen to,even if you just listen to it via Google Videos.
